The SAMR Model: Transforming Your Students' Learning Environment through Effective Technology

Image
Screenshot from  Transformation, Technology, and Education  Presentation The SAMR model guides edtech specialists and teachers in designing technology-integrated units to transform the learning environment. It is also a reflective tool for teachers to fine-tune their practices and pedagogy that involve technology. Dr. Ruben Puentedura , a consultant in education technology, developed the SAMR model to categorize technology usage into four technological levels: substitution, augmentation, modification, and redefinition. The Substitution level is the lowest level of technology usage in the model. Students use a technology that replaces a traditional tool, but results in no change in functionality. In the Augmentation level, a traditional tool is also replaced with a new technology, but the result is a small enhancement in functionality.
